What's "One Question: Life-Changing Answers from Today's Leading Voices" about?
- Concept Overview: The book is a collection of interviews conducted by Ken Coleman with influential figures across various fields. Each interview is centered around a single, thought-provoking question.
- Purpose: It aims to provide readers with insights and wisdom from successful individuals, offering guidance on personal and professional growth.
- Structure: The book is divided into sections focusing on different themes such as succeeding, surviving, and sustaining, each containing interviews with experts in those areas.
- Author's Approach: Ken Coleman uses his interviewing skills to extract meaningful answers that can inspire and challenge readers to think deeply about their own lives.

What are the best quotes from "One Question: Life-Changing Answers from Today's Leading Voices" and what do they mean?
- "You don’t take donkeys to the Kentucky Derby." - Pat Summitt's father; emphasizes the importance of surrounding yourself with the right people to achieve success.
- "Success without fulfillment is failure." - Tony Robbins; highlights that true success is not just about achievements but also about personal satisfaction and growth.
- "A good plan violently executed today is better than a perfect plan executed next week." - General Patton, quoted by Patrick Lencioni; underscores the value of decisiveness and action over perfection.
- "Leadership is not about love—it is love." - Margie Blanchard; suggests that effective leadership is rooted in genuine care and connection with others.

What advice does John Maxwell give about finding one's niche in "One Question"?
- Passions and Strengths: Maxwell advises identifying what you are passionate about and what you are good at, and then combining the two to find your niche.
- Avoiding Misalignment: He warns against pursuing something you are passionate about but not skilled in, or something you are skilled in but not passionate about.
- Courage to Change: Maxwell encourages people to have the courage to quit what they are doing if it doesn't align with their niche and to pursue what truly fits them.
- Long-term Fulfillment: Finding and operating within your niche leads to long-term satisfaction and success, as it aligns with your true self.

How does Ken Blanchard define leading with love in "One Question"?
- Building Relationships: Blanchard emphasizes the importance of building quality relationships with employees and customers.
- Reciprocal Trust: He believes that love, trust, and caring between leadership and employees lead to organizational success.
- Regular Engagement: Blanchard suggests regular one-on-one meetings with direct reports to foster genuine relationships and engagement.
- Love as Leadership: He concludes that leadership is not just about love; it is love, encompassing mission, people, and self-awareness.
What insights does Tony Robbins provide on achieving fulfillment in "One Question"?
- Breakthrough Moments: Robbins talks about the importance of breakthroughs where the impossible becomes possible.
- Strategy, Story, State: He identifies three areas for breakthroughs: having the right strategy, an empowering story, and a positive state of mind.
- Changing Your State: Robbins suggests that changing your physical state can influence your mental state and lead to better outcomes.
- Sustained Success: Achieving fulfillment involves not just reaching goals but also maintaining a positive and empowered mindset.

What role does feedback play in Jack Dorsey's process as discussed in "One Question"?
- Early Feedback: Dorsey emphasizes the importance of seeking feedback early in the process of developing an idea.
- Third-party Perspective: He believes that getting an outside perspective helps refine ideas and improve them.
- Inspiration from Feedback: Dorsey views feedback as a source of inspiration that can drive a product forward.
- Avoiding Isolation: He warns against working in a vacuum and stresses the value of diverse opinions in the innovation process.
Review Summary
One Question received mostly positive reviews, with readers praising its thought-provoking content and unique approach of asking experts a single, impactful question. Many found the book insightful, inspiring, and easy to read, appreciating the diverse range of topics covered. Some readers noted the book's practical wisdom and its ability to spark curiosity. However, a few reviewers felt the format was repetitive or lacked depth. Overall, the book was well-received for its valuable life lessons and encouragement to ask meaningful questions.
